1. What three words describe you as a mother?
Loving, Disciplined, Selfless
2. What’s the parenting rule you never break?
Just try it whether it’s a food, activity, etc you HAVE to try it at least once before saying you don’t like it.
3. And one rule you do break?
Bedtime, there’s really no set bedtime in our house and if something comes up, its ok, we work around it.
4. How do you spend time off for yourself?
I workout or I write.
5. What’s the best part of your day?
After the kids are in bed and the chores are done and I can sit with some tea and do some of my work online.
6. What’s your favourite guilty pleasure?
Chocolate
7. What five things can always be found in your refrigerator?
Milk, eggs, cheese, grapes, sun-dried tomatoes
8. What words describe you as a wife and a mom?
Dedicated.
9. Do you have a family ritual that you love?
We always pray together and I love it. the kids look forward to it.
10. What are 3 best things you love to teach your child?
I teach them to always be kind, to show respect to everyone(especially elders) and I teach them to do everything to the best of their ability.
